The Detroit Lions have made headlines with their decision to hire Drew Petzing as the new offensive coordinator. Although the announcement is yet to become official, the news broke unexpectedly on Monday afternoon, surprising many fans and analysts alike. Petzing’s interview with the Lions reportedly took place last week but did not leak beforehand, leaving him off most fans’ radars.

Insights on Drew Petzing’s Hiring

Drew Petzing is not a familiar name to many within the Lions’ fanbase, primarily because he has no direct connection to head coach Dan Campbell. Despite this, analysts and experts have been quick to offer their thoughts on Petzing’s capabilities and potential impact on the team.

Expert Opinions on Petzing’s Coaching Skills

  • Several analysts praise Petzing’s comprehensive understanding of the game.
  • Former colleagues have described him as one of the smartest coaches they’ve encountered.
  • His background in coaching various positions—running backs, wide receivers, and quarterbacks—helps broaden his coaching perspective.

One former player remarked, “He’s very, very intelligent. If you give him a school book, he would make all A’s.” This reflects his deep comprehension of offensive plays and formations. His peers have noted that this extensive knowledge was apparent even when he was in assistant roles, predicting his ascension to an offensive coordinator position.
